自动将私人应用程序发送给客户端

时间:2019-08-13 09:59:59

标签: android

我们有几个客户使用相同的应用程序。出于安全原因,该应用无法发布到Google Play,因此我们手动将其分发给客户。

问题在于,每次有新版本的应用程序时,我们都必须联系所有客户并更新其所有应用程序。

是否没有办法在Google Play上拥有私人应用程序并授予不同的客户端访问权限,以便他们可以下载这些应用程序的更新?

我已经看到了,但是我不确定它的行为是否符合我的预期:https://support.google.com/googleplay/android-developer/answer/3131213?hl=en#runtest

3 个答案:

答案 0 :(得分:1)

您当然可以,但Play商店中提供了一个内部测试应用程序版本,您可以在其中上传您的应用程序版本。上传后,您将拥有一个私人链接,只有有权访问该链接的人才能下载该应用程序。

答案 1 :(得分:0)

我想您可以发布为应用程序https://support.google.com/googleplay/answer/7003180的“测试版”版本。您可以将客户定义为Beta测试人员,并且只有他们才能在市场上看到该应用。

答案 2 :(得分:-1)

我有一种方法,假设您的网站中有一个.apk文件。每个客户都可以从这里下载。现在,每当用户使用您的应用程序时,您都必须进行API调用,以通过将版本详细信息发送到服务器来确保他们使用的是最新版本的应用程序。如果用户使用的是旧版本(您将从服务器/ api响应中获得此信息),请阻止屏幕并将其重定向到服务器以下载新的.apk。 您可以将响应存储到本地/数据库,以便他们也不能在脱机模式下使用您的应用程序。